Delhi: Motilal Banarsidass, 2001. 1st. Hardcover. Very Good/Very Good. Hardcover in a bright dust jacket, 212 pages, b&w illustrations. This book is an attempt to explain the most basic ritual called lsti with the help of the original texts and the photographs of the actual performance of that sacrifice that took place in Pune, India, in July 1979. The book contains in all 140 photographs showing various stages of the sacrifice with explanation of the rites. Clean copy. Record # 379879
